Samsung Galaxy A01 mobile was launched on 18th December 2019. The phone comes with a 5.70-inch touchscreen display. Samsung Galaxy A01 is powered by an octa-core processor that features 4 cores clocked at 1.95GHz and 4 cores clocked at 1.45GHz. It comes with 2GB of RAM. The Samsung Galaxy A01 runs Android and is powered by a 3000mAh battery.
As far as the cameras are concerned, the Samsung Galaxy A01 on the rear packs a 13-megapixel (f/2.2) primary camera, and a 2-megapixel (f/2.4) camera. It sports a 5-megapixel camera on the front for selfies with an f/2.0 aperture.
Samsung Galaxy A01 is based on Android and packs 16GB of inbuilt storage that can be expanded via microSD card with a dedicated slot. The Samsung Galaxy A01 measures 146.30 x 70.88 x 8.34mm (height x width x thickness) . It was launched in Black, Blue, and Red colours.
Connectivity options on the Samsung Galaxy A01 include Wi-Fi. Sensors on the phone include accelerometer, ambient light sensor, and proximity sensor.
